The Jefferson County Sheriff’s Office is seeking charges against a 35-year-old De Soto woman for allegedly stealing prescription medicine and selling it to others.
Sometime on April 13, the woman allegedly stole several medications, including trazodone, latramogine, Seroquel, Ambien, Xanax and Soma, as well as some clothing from a home in the 13000 block of Hwy. JJ in the De Soto area, where her boyfriend lived, the Jefferson County Sheriff’s Office reports.
In all, the items were valued at about $900, the report said.
The victim had recorded a conversation he had with his girlfriend when she allegedly admitted to stealing and then selling the medication, according to the report.
Charges for stealing and distribution of a controlled substance will be sought against the woman through the Jefferson County Prosecuting Attorney’s Office, said Capt. Ron Arnhart of the Sheriff’s Office.
